Liskerrett Community Cinema , The Ghost Writer |
| 7:30pm - 9:40pm |
Liskerrett Community Cinema presents The Ghost Writer (2010) Certificate 15, Starring Ewan McGregor, Pierce Brosnan. When a successful British ghost writer agrees to complete the memories of former British Prime Minister Adam Langt, his agent assures him it's the opportunity of a lifetime. But the project seems doomed from the start - not least because his predecessor died in an unfortunate accident. The 'ghost' quickly discovers that the past can be deadly and that history is decided by whoever stays alive long enough. Liskerrett Community Centre, Varley Lane, Liskeard PL14 4AP |

Cinema by the Sea presents "Julie and Julia" |
| 7:00pm - 9:45pm |
Showing at The Community Hall, Looe Children's Centre, Barbican, LOOE PL13 1ET. Doors open at 7pm. High definition projection and surround sound. Members of Looe Film Society £3, Adults £5, Students & under 18s £3.
A fun foodie film. Meryl Streep plays Julia Child, who in 1949 is in Paris, the wife of a diplomat, wondering how to spend her time – until cooking lessons at Cordon Bleu release her passion. In 2002 in New York, Julie Powell decides to cook and blog her way through Child’s "Mastering the Art of French Cooking". The two stories interweave, with enough delicious food to make you feel hungry! 24hr information line 0845 868 1021 (local call rate) |

Plymouth Dakar Challenge |
| 1:00am - 12:00am |
The worlds longest running banger challenge. Drive a car from Plymouth to Gambia or Timbuctu, well obviously you take the ferry first! Cars are auctioned for charity before you fly home. The route is France/Spain/Morocco/Mauritania/Senegal/Mali or Gambia 01392 881748 Julian Nowill |
